Overview

A lathe special machine is a highly customized version of a standard lathe, designed to perform specific machining tasks with exceptional precision and efficiency. These machines are engineered to meet unique production requirements that standard lathes cannot fulfill, making them indispensable in industries like automotive, aerospace, and heavy machinery. Special lathes are often integrated with advanced automation systems, such as CNC (Computer Numerical Control), to enhance productivity and reduce human error. Their ability to handle complex geometries and materials makes them a preferred choice for high-volume or specialized manufacturing processes.

Structure and Working Principle

The structure of a lathe special machine typically includes a robust bed, headstock, tailstock, and carriage, similar to conventional lathes. However, it may feature additional components like multi-axis spindles, custom tooling, or automated loading systems tailored to specific tasks. These machines operate on the same fundamental principle as standard lathes, where the workpiece rotates while a cutting tool removes material to achieve the desired shape. The key difference lies in their customization, which allows for specialized operations such as high-speed turning, precision threading, or complex contouring.

Key Features

Lathe special machines are distinguished by their high precision, adaptability, and efficiency. They often incorporate advanced control systems, such as CNC, to ensure repeatability and accuracy in mass production. Another notable feature is their modular design, which enables easy upgrades or modifications to accommodate changing production needs. These machines may also include coolant systems, vibration dampeners, and other enhancements to improve performance and tool life.

Application Areas

Lathe special machines are widely used in industries requiring high-precision components, such as automotive manufacturing for engine parts, aerospace for turbine blades, and medical devices for implants. They are also employed in the energy sector for machining large-scale components like wind turbine shafts. Their versatility and customization options make them suitable for niche applications where standard machines fall short.

Maintenance and Precautions

Regular maintenance is crucial for ensuring the longevity and performance of lathe special machines. This includes routine lubrication, calibration, and inspection of critical components like spindles and bearings. Operators must adhere to strict safety protocols, including wearing protective gear and following machine-specific guidelines. Proper training is essential to minimize the risk of accidents and ensure optimal machine operation.

B2B Procurement Guide

When procuring a lathe special machine, it's important to clearly define your production requirements, including material specifications, tolerances, and output volume. Collaborate closely with manufacturers to ensure the machine meets your exact needs. Consider factors like after-sales support, warranty terms, and the availability of spare parts. Request demonstrations or trials to evaluate the machine's performance before finalizing the purchase.
